Somalia’s Security is Our Priority, Declares Egyptian President Al-Sisi

(21-01-24) CAIRO (Halqabsi News) — Egyptian President Abdel Fattah Al-Sisi, in a defining statement of solidarity, has reiterated Egypt’s steadfast commitment to Somalia’s security amidst growing regional tensions. This declaration was made during a significant joint press conference with Somali President Hassan Sheikh Mohamud in Cairo on Sunday.

Taking a firm stance, President Al-Sisi vociferously opposed the Ethiopia-Somaliland Memorandum of Understanding, a contentious agreement involving a region within Somalia. He underscored Egypt’s vehement opposition to the Ethiopia-Somaliland Red Sea agreement, which is seen by Somalia as a direct violation of its sovereignty.

“It is not in anyone’s interest to test Egypt’s patience or threaten its brothers, especially if they requested Egypt’s intervention,” Al-Sisi cautioned. He underscored Egypt’s resolve to counter any external threats to Somalia’s national security, reflecting a deep commitment to regional stability.

Crucially, President Al-Sisi invoked the Arab League’s principles to further emphasize Egypt’s position. “The law of the Arab League stipulates that we must jointly defend an Arab country facing an existential threat. Therefore, the Egyptian government cannot accept any interference that violates the unity and security of Somalia,” Al-Sisi stated. This reference to the Arab League’s law highlights Egypt’s adherence to collective defence and solidarity with fellow Arab nations, especially in times of crisis.

Al-Sisi continued to emphasize Somalia’s integral position within the Arab world and pointed to the rights and protections afforded to Somalia under the Arab League Charter. He reiterated Egypt’s commitment to collective defence strategies against threats to Somalia, assuring proactive measures to safeguard Somali national security.

In his concluding remarks, Al-Sisi firmly asserted, “Egypt stands resolute in its commitment to Somalia’s security. No external actor will be allowed to threaten the Somali people or jeopardize their safety. We are unwavering in our support for our brethren, and if they call upon us, we will not hesitate to act.”

The joint press conference represents a robust united front between Egypt and Somalia against perceived regional threats. It underscores the critical role of regional cooperation and collective defence in maintaining stability in the Horn of Africa.
